如何手动将 Worklight 从 6.1.0.0 更新到 6.1.0.1(损坏的 IIM 安装)

Posted

技术标签:

【中文标题】如何手动将 Worklight 从 6.1.0.0 更新到 6.1.0.1(损坏的 IIM 安装)【英文标题】:How to update manually Worklight from 6.1.0.0 to 6.1.0.1 (corrupted IIM install) 【发布时间】:2014-05-18 20:31:19 【问题描述】:

我有一些安装了损坏的 WL 6.1.0.0 的服务器 - IIM 没有在历史记录中显示它,所以我不能以传统方式应用修复包。

我需要以某种非传统方式将 WL 6.1.0.0 更新到 6.1.0.1。

最初我认为 FixPack 001 的主要任务是更新 /opt/IBM/Worklight/WorklightServer/ 文件 worklight-ant-builder.jar, worklight-ant-deployer.jar , worklight-jee-library.jar (除了我不需要的 WAR 应用程序更新 - 我们不使用 App Center Console,WL 应用程序是使用 Studio 6.1.0.1 构建的 - 无需更新)

我计划从更新的服务器复制 JAR 文件,但与另一个更新(通过 IIM)到 6.1.0.1 的服务器相比,我发现这些文件是一样的(但是关于菜单告诉 6.1.0.1 服务器版本)。

6.1.0.0服务器上没有使用App Center Console(其实我是通过WAS web admin console卸载的)

所以,我的问题是:如何手动更新 WL 6.1.0.0 到 6.1.0.1,可能以不受支持的方式?

【问题讨论】:

【参考方案1】:

我不熟悉手动方式,但您可能应该阅读并执行此用户文档主题中推荐的步骤:Upgrading from Worklight Server V6.1.0 to V6.1.0.1 in a production environment。

强烈建议也看看at the parent topic。

【讨论】:

我确实从 InfoCenter 阅读了所有主题,但从该链接中所有与任何 修改 无关的任务(因为大多数任务只是启动/停止服务器/应用程序)是运行 Ant 任务“最小更新”,但我相信它与安装的 WAR 更新有关。假设 Worklight 库已经通过 IIM 更新到 FixPack 001,它使 WAR 符合新的次要修订版。 修复在工作室插件中。更新并再次检查。 我不确定我是否关注你。我们确实在 WL Studio 6.1.0.1 中使用,但服务器仍保持在 6.1.0.0。 WL studio 插件如何更新 WL 服务器? 是的,我认为在错误的问题中发表了评论。 :-) 为什么不使用上述步骤使用备份再次尝试升级?

以上是关于如何手动将 Worklight 从 6.1.0.0 更新到 6.1.0.1(损坏的 IIM 安装)的主要内容,如果未能解决你的问题,请参考以下文章

IBM Worklight - 如何将参数从应用程序传递到适配器?

如何将域、端口号、用户名和密码从用户输入传递到 Worklight http 适配器

将项目从 WorkLight 6.2 升级到 MobileFirst 7.1

将 Worklight 应用程序添加到现有的本机应用程序

IBM Worklight 6.1 - 无法重新生成 iPhone 本机文件夹

IBM Worklight - 如何从 Mac OS 的 6.2 切换回 6.1 版? [关闭]